Cruise Lines Serving Charleston
- Carnival Cruise Line: Carnival is a well-known cruise line known for its fun and family-friendly atmosphere. They offer a range of itineraries from Charleston, often including stops at popular Caribbean islands. Their ships are typically larger, offering a wide array of onboard amenities and activities. Specific itineraries and ship assignments vary seasonally; check their website for the most up-to-date information.
- Royal Caribbean International: Royal Caribbean is another major player in the cruise industry, known for their innovative ships and diverse itineraries. While their presence in Charleston might be less consistent than Carnival, it is worth checking their schedule for possible departures. They often feature a variety of onboard activities tailored to different age groups and interests.
- Other Potential Lines: While Carnival and Royal Caribbean are the most frequently seen lines departing from Charleston, occasionally other cruise lines will offer itineraries from this port. It’s always best to search directly with cruise booking sites or the cruise lines themselves to see what’s currently available.

Popular Cruise Itineraries from Charleston
Cruise itineraries from Charleston vary depending on the cruise line and the time of year. Many itineraries focus on the Caribbean, offering a blend of beach relaxation, historical exploration, and vibrant nightlife. However, some shorter itineraries may also be available, including Bahamian cruises or explorations of the Southeastern coast.
- Caribbean Cruises: These are the most common itineraries from Charleston, offering stops at various Caribbean islands. The islands visited might include Nassau, Grand Cayman, or other popular destinations depending on the cruise line and duration of the cruise.
- Bahama Cruises: Some shorter cruises from Charleston may focus on the Bahamas, offering a quicker getaway for those with less vacation time. These usually involve visiting Nassau or other Bahamian islands known for their beautiful beaches and relaxed atmosphere.
- Coastal Cruises: Less frequent but occasionally available, coastal cruises explore the beautiful coastline of the southeastern United States. These cruises might offer a charming blend of history, natural beauty, and small-town charm.

Exploring Historic Charleston
Charleston’s historic district is a treasure trove of architectural marvels and historical sites. Consider spending a day or two exploring its cobblestone streets, antebellum mansions, and charming boutiques. Explore Rainbow Row, visit Fort Sumter, or wander through the city market for a taste of Charleston’s unique character. You can immerse yourself in the region’s history and culture.
